Abstract The temperature dependence of the proton NMR‐spectra of bis(1,3‐diphenyl‐1,3‐propanedionato)Ni(II) and of bis(1,3‐di‐ p ‐tolyl‐1,3‐propanedionato)Ni(II) has been determined. We have interpreted the results using a model with two unpaired electrons per molecule. We conclude that the contact shifts of the various proton resonance signals result from delocalized unpaired electrons in the σ as well as the π system of the ligands.
